Job Summary

The janitor cleans and keeps in an orderly condition of duties that involve a combination of the following: Sweeping, mopping or scrubbing, and polishing floors; removing chips, trash, and other refuse; dusting equipment, furniture, or fixtures; polishing metal fixtures or trimmings; providing supplies and minor maintenance services; and cleaning lavatories, showers, and restrooms.

Primary Duties

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. These duties and responsibilities will be rated on the Annual Performance Review.

  • Responsible for the overall care of the building and the grounds and following proper cleaning procedures.
  • Vacuum, dust, sweep, mop, empty trash around the different areas of the building on a daily basis.
  • Use various equipment utilized in the process of daily housekeeping tasks, such as operate floor buffer machine and scrubber machine to clean rugs around the building.
  • Clean glass of all doorways and entrances to offices.
  • Monitors building security and safety by performing such tasks as locking doors after cleaning offices.
  • Notify management of need for repairs when necessary.
  • Perform other responsibilities as assigned.
Qualifications

Education, Experience, and Certification(s)

  • High school diploma or General Educational Development (GED) preferred.
  • Previous experience in custodial field preferred.
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
  • Ability to comprehend basic written and oral instructions.
  • Internal and external customer service skills.
  • Ability to cooperate with others, good personal and grooming habits.
  • Ability to maintain a clean and orderly working area to maximize efficiency.
Physical Demands

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to walk and stand; bend and stoop; reach with hands and arms; and talk or hear. The employee is occasionally required to kneel and sit. The employee may regularly lift or move products and supplies, up to 25 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, depth perception, and ability to adjust focus.

Work Environment

While performing the duties of this job, the employee is occasionally exposed to outside weather conditions. The noise level in the work environment is usually quiet to moderate.

However, employees who have access to the compensation information of other employees or applicants as a part of their essential job functions cannot disclose the pay of other employees or applicants to individuals who do not otherwise have access to compensation information, unless the disclosure is (a) in response to a formal complaint or charge, (b) in furtherance of an investigation, proceeding, hearing, or action, including an investigation conducted by the employer, or (c) consistent with the contractor’s legal duty to furnish information ServiceSource is a 501(c)(3) organization with programs and operations in more than a dozen states and the District of Columbia. ServiceSource has affiliate organizations in Delaware, Florida, North Carolina, Utah and Virginia. Collectively, the organization serves more than 35,000 individuals with disabilities annually through a range of innovative and valued employment, training, habilitation, housing and other support services.

Our proven collaborative approach helps foster a community where individuals with disabilities can succeed and thrive. Strategic partnerships with local community businesses, government entities and nonprofits help bridge the gaps for individuals with disabilities, creating sustainable opportunities that benefit the entire community and result in greater independence for the individual.
